Altcoin Season Index is a key market indicator tracked by the industry, measuring how strongly altcoins perform compared to Bitcoin in the cryptocurrency market.
- Altcoin Season: When the index value rises and passes a certain threshold (usually above 75), it is considered "Altseason"—a period when the altcoin market performs much better than Bitcoin.
- Bitcoin Season: If the index value is low (usually below 25), it indicates a period where Bitcoin increases its market dominance and altcoins lag behind.
- Neutral Zone: If the index is at a medium level, the market is balanced and there is no clear altseason or Bitcoin season.
How to Interpret?
- If the index is 75 or above, altcoins have recently outperformed Bitcoin by a wide margin. This is generally considered an "Altseason" signal.
- If the index is 25 or below, the market is moving mainly with Bitcoin, and altcoins have lagged behind.
- At medium values, the market is indecisive or neutral, with no clear trend.
